Output 30e53d325d9961c5d33e0316174df5c7a59ef7fae33d7ef32dbea11b2d15e314:2

value
5854799
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f7505e4a4aa7cf1f49b055444d1bf31cfb8eb52 OP_EQUAL
address
3EmYjsr726BHufPEeDdsKNPkhVwDHKmkqF
transaction
30e53d325d9961c5d33e0316174df5c7a59ef7fae33d7ef32dbea11b2d15e314
spent
true